    The inserts are not glued to the padding they are glued to the backing which is on top of the padding, the green fibers are shaved down to the backing and the new fibers which already has backing on it is glued down. The product is much like the carpet in a home. So if the turf ever needs to be restreched every thing will move as one piece. _
